openclaw skills install agentnsRegister and manage ICANN domains for AI agents. Wallet authentication (SIWE/SIWS), USDC payments on Base or Solana, full DNS management.
openclaw skills install agentnsUse this skill when you need to register domains, check domain availability, or manage DNS records for an agent or project.
pip install agentns-client
# For Solana wallet support:
pip install agentns-client[solana]
from agentns_client import AgentNSClient, load_or_create_wallet
# 1. Create client with wallet (auto-creates wallet.json if needed)
account = load_or_create_wallet()
client = AgentNSClient(account=account)
# 2. Check domain availability (no auth required)
result = client.check_domain("myagent.xyz")
if not result.available:
print(f"{result.domain} is not available")
# Search across 20 TLDs to find alternatives
results = client.search_domains("myagent")
available = [r for r in results if r.available]
for r in available:
print(f"{r.domain}: ${r.price_usdc} USDC")
# 3. Authenticate with wallet signature
client.login()
# 4. Create registrant profile (one-time, ICANN requirement)
client.ensure_registrant({
"name": "Agent Smith",
"street_address": "123 AI Street",
"city": "San Francisco",
"state_province": "CA",
"postal_code": "94102",
"country_code": "US",
"email": "contact@agentns.xyz",
"phone": "+14155551234",
})
# 5. Register domain (payment handled automatically)
domain = client.register_domain("myagent.xyz")
print(f"Registered: {domain.domain}")
print(f"Expires: {domain.expires_at}")
# 6. Add DNS records
client.add_dns("myagent.xyz", type="A", host="@", value="192.0.2.1")
client.add_dns("myagent.xyz", type="CNAME", host="www", value="myagent.xyz")
client.add_dns("myagent.xyz", type="TXT", host="@", value="v=spf1 -all")
EVM (Base network - default):
from agentns_client import load_or_create_wallet
account = load_or_create_wallet("wallet.json") # Creates if missing
print(f"Address: {account.address}")
# Fund with USDC on Base network before registering
Solana:
from agentns_client import load_or_create_solana_wallet
keypair = load_or_create_solana_wallet("solana_wallet.json")
print(f"Address: {keypair.pubkey()}")
# Fund with USDC on Solana before registering
# Check single domain (no auth)
result = client.check_domain("example.com")
# Returns: DomainCheck(domain, available, price_usdc)
# Search across 20 TLDs (no auth)
results = client.search_domains("mycompany")
# Searches: com, io, net, co, ai, xyz, dev, app, org, tech,
# club, online, site, info, me, biz, us, cc, tv, gg
# Register domain (requires auth + USDC balance)
domain = client.register_domain("example.xyz", years=1)
# Returns: DomainInfo(domain, owner_address, status, registered_at, expires_at)
# List owned domains
domains = client.list_domains()
# List DNS records
records = client.list_dns("example.xyz")
# Add record
record = client.add_dns(
domain="example.xyz",
type="A", # A, AAAA, CNAME, MX, TXT, SRV, CAA
host="@", # @ for root, or subdomain name
value="192.0.2.1",
ttl=3600, # 300-86400 seconds
distance=10 # Required for MX/SRV only
)
# Update record
client.update_dns("example.xyz", record_id="12345", value="192.0.2.2")
# Delete record
client.delete_dns("example.xyz", record_id="12345")
# Get current nameservers
ns = client.get_nameservers("example.xyz")
# Default: ["ns1.namesilo.com", "ns2.namesilo.com"]
# Change to custom nameservers (e.g., Cloudflare)
client.set_nameservers("example.xyz", [
"ns1.cloudflare.com",
"ns2.cloudflare.com"
])
# Get profile
profile = client.get_registrant()
# Create profile (required before first domain registration)
profile = client.create_registrant({
"name": "Required Name",
"street_address": "123 Main St",
"city": "San Francisco",
"state_province": "CA",
"postal_code": "94102",
"country_code": "US", # ISO 3166-1 alpha-2
"email": "contact@agentns.xyz",
"phone": "+14155551234",
"organization": "Optional Org", # Optional
"whois_privacy": True # Optional, default True
})
# Update profile
client.update_registrant({"email": "new@example.com"})
# Get or create (recommended)
profile = client.ensure_registrant({...})
from agentns_client.exceptions import (
AgentNSError, # Base exception
AuthenticationError, # Invalid/expired JWT (401)
PaymentRequiredError, # Insufficient USDC balance (402)
NotFoundError, # Domain/record not found (404)
ConflictError, # Profile exists, domain taken (409)
ValidationError, # Invalid input (400)
RateLimitError, # Too many requests (429)
)
try:
domain = client.register_domain("example.xyz")
except PaymentRequiredError as e:
print(f"Need {e.payment_requirement.amount} USDC")
print(f"Send to: {client.wallet_address}")
except ConflictError:
print("Domain already registered or unavailable")
except AuthenticationError:
client.login() # Re-authenticate
